I have a new batch of chicks, between 5 and 7 weeks old. I pieced the flock together over a couple week period.

My question is: because they are not free ranging just yet, do I need to give them chick grit before giving them treats like strawberries, lettuce, or tomatoes?

So far all I have fed them is chick starter crumbles and a little dried oregano, when someone had a little diarrhea.

Your help is appreciated.

Sally
 
Yupp! If your feeding them anything other than their regular feed, they need grit. I reccomend chick grit though (it's smaller) instead of adult poultry grit.
